# Eventforge Schema Registry — Environments

Three environments: dev, staging, prod. Promotions go dev → staging → prod, no skipping. Staging mirrors prod compatibility mode (BACKWARD_TRANSITIVE); dev allows NONE for experiments. Release manager signs off on schema promotions during the Tuesday freeze window. Rollbacks re-pin the previous schema version, never delete. Each environment runs its own registry instance with the settings below.

config for bafof-tajef:
[silion]
port = 5000
team = silmir
host = silion.crelvonet.internal
region = lower-3
access_code = ac_1f1b57
timeout_ms = 2000

Support team: use this procedure only when garbage-collection pauses in PairPoint exceed 30 seconds and the matcher stops assigning sessions. Normal mitigation (rolling restart via the Helm console) should always be tried first. If restarts fail and the on-call engineer is unreachable, break-glass access lets you toggle the GC tuning flags directly in production. Every use is audited and reviewed the next business day, so note the incident ticket before proceeding. Unlock the emergency console with the recovery passphrase below.

recovery phrase for fawif-tajeg: norael-aldmir-casir-brivan-ulaion

**Changelog — SQLint Rules Key Rotation**

Quick one for the sync: we rotated the signing key for the sqlint-rules package after the old one hit expiry. All SQL linting rule bundles from v2.6 onward are signed with the new key, so update your local trust config or CI will grumble at you. Old bundles still verify for two weeks. New key below.

deploy key for kajof-fajop: bky6_gDHw9Q

Support team, please review before we close this. The webhook was double-firing delivery notifications when the Harwick sorting hub sent duplicate scan events within a two-second window. The fix adds deduplication keyed on scan event sequence numbers and extends the retry backoff to reduce load on the notification service. Customer-facing impact: affected recipients may have received duplicate texts last week; a template apology is drafted. Before deployment, this change requires written sign-off from the responsible engineer.

named custodian: Brivan Eliath Quenox Frador